jQuery表单验证之密码确认

网络编程 2025-03-29 15:59www.168986.cn编程入门

这篇文章主要介绍了如何使用jQuery来实现表单验证中的密码确认功能。在实际修改密码的场景中,通常需要用户两次输入密码以确保输入的正确性。那么,如何确保两个密码框中的内容既有值又相互一致呢?这一切都可以通过JavaScript来实现。

我们需要为两个密码框都添加失去焦点的blur事件。利用jQuery可以更方便地实现这一操作。在HTML代码中,我们有两个密码输入框,分别用于用户输入密码和确认密码。还有一个提示信息,当两次输入的密码不一致时,会显示“两次输入的密码不一致”的提示。

接下来是具体的实现代码。当第一个密码框失去焦点时,会触发checkpas1事件。在这个事件中,我们首先获取两个密码框的值。然后判断,如果两个密码不相等且第二个密码框中有值,就显示错误信息;否则,隐藏错误信息。这样,在用户输入的过程中,就可以实时地判断两个密码是否一致,并给出相应的提示。

这种实现方式的好处在于,它可以在用户输入的过程中进行实时的验证,提高用户体验。通过jQuery的使用,可以更方便地操作DOM元素,使代码更加简洁易懂。我们还使用了HTML的表单验证功能,通过required属性确保用户在提交表单前必须填写密码框。

代码解读:

这段代码中包含了两个函数`checkpas()`和`checkpas2()`,它们的主要功能是在网页上的密码输入过程中进行密码校验。当用户在两个密码框中输入的密码不一致时,通过JavaScript进行提示。代码中还包含了一些HTML标签和脚本标签。

《网页密码校验功能》

今天我们来一下网页中的密码校验功能。这一功能对于确保用户账户安全至关重要。在实际开发中,我们经常需要编写代码来验证用户输入的密码是否一致。下面是一个简单的示例代码,让我们一起来理解一下。

在HTML部分,我们有两个密码输入框,分别用于用户输入初次密码和确认密码。我们还有一些提示信息,用于在用户输入密码时给出相应的反馈。

接下来是JavaScript部分。我们定义了两个函数`checkpas()`和`checkpas2()`。当用户在第一个密码框输入完毕后移开焦点时,会触发`checkpas()`函数,它会获取两个密码框中的值进行比较。如果两个密码不一致,就会显示错误信息;如果一致,则隐藏错误信息。而`checkpas2()`函数则在用户点击提交按钮时触发,它同样会进行密码比对。如果两次输入的密码不一致,会弹出一个提示框提醒用户。这样做可以有效防止用户忽视错误信息而提交表单。

这个功能的实现相对简单,只要掌握了基本的HTML和JavaScript知识,就能轻松上手。在实际开发中,我们还需要考虑更多的安全性和用户体验方面的因素。

以上就是本文的全部内容,希望对大家的学习有所帮助。如果你对这篇文章有任何疑问或者建议,欢迎随时提出。也希望大家多多支持我们的SEO学习交流社区——狼蚁SEO。

我们希望能够帮助大家更好地理解网页密码校验功能的实现原理,并在实际开发中加以应用。如有任何疑问或建议,请随时与我们交流。让我们一起学习进步!

(注:以上代码和文章内容仅为示例,实际开发中需要根据具体需求进行调整和优化。)

上一篇:大数据HelloWorld-Flink实现WordCount 下一篇:没有了

Copyright © 2016-2025 www.168986.cn 狼蚁网络 版权所有 Power by